Hi Jonathan Le 29 avr. 2015 23:40, "Jonathan Fisher" <[email protected]> a écrit : > > Hey guys, > > Is is possible to have TomEE use Moxy as the default jaxb provider?
Add the jar(s) to tomee lib and set openejb jaxrs providers system property: openejb.cxf.jax-rs.providers=moxyqualifiedname > If not, > is it possible to override it for an application? Using openejb-jar.xml or adding it in classes in your jaxrs application works as well: https://rmannibucau.wordpress.com/2013/01/09/tomeeopenejb-jaxrs-refactoring/ > In Tomcat 1.7, our > @XMLRootElement and @XMLElement are being ignored and I think we want to > switch to a third party provider to get some consistency during upgrades. > This is weird since we have a jaxb provider by default - cxf one. Maybe something to investigate. For xml i never got any issue but i know cxf jaxb provider has some more config for it. If you speak about json you can still activate cxf one just adding back jettison. > *Jonathan S.
